4. Setup & Assembly

The R3 electric bicycle comes highly assembled. Follow these steps to prepare your bike for its first ride:

  1. Unfolding the Bike: Carefully unfold the main frame until it locks securely. Ensure all quick-release levers are properly fastened.
  2. Handlebar Adjustment: Raise the handlebar stem to your desired height and secure the quick-release lever. Ensure the pin is locked to prevent wobbling.
  3. Seat Adjustment: Adjust the seat post height for a comfortable riding position, ensuring your feet can touch the ground when stopped. Secure the quick-release lever.
  4. Pedal Installation: Attach the pedals using the provided tools. Note that pedals are typically marked 'L' for left and 'R' for right.
  5. Battery Activation: Insert the key into the ignition port (located underneath the frame near the folding mechanism) and turn it clockwise to activate the battery.
  6. Initial Charge: Fully charge the battery before your first ride.

5. Components & Features

Gotrax R3 Folding Electric Bike in white

Image: The Gotrax R3 Folding Electric Bike, showcasing its overall design and robust tires.

  • Motor: 500W brushless motor, providing a top speed of 20 MPH.
  • Gears: Shimano 7-speed gear system for versatile riding.
  • Tires: 20" x 4" wear-resistant tires suitable for various terrains.
  • Battery: 48V 13.6AH Lithium battery.
  • Range: Up to 70 miles in pedal-assist mode (level 1) and 28 miles in pure electric mode.
  • Charging Time: Approximately 5 hours for a full charge.
  • Brakes: Dual disc brakes for effective stopping power.
  • Suspension: Front shock absorber for a smoother ride.
  • Lighting: LED headlight and rear reflector for visibility.
  • Display: Smart LCD display showing real-time battery, mileage, speed, and error codes.
  • Riding Modes: Pure electric mode, pedal assist mode (5 levels), and bicycle mode.
  • Folding: Easy-to-fold design for compact storage (folded size: 35.4"x20.5"x29.3").
  • Rear Rack: Sturdy rear rack for carrying items.

6. Operating Instructions

LCD Display Functions:

  • Energy Bar: Displays remaining battery level.
  • Speed: Shows current riding speed (MPH or KM/H).
  • PAS (Pedal Assist Level): Indicates the current pedal assist level (0-5).
  • ODO (Odometer): Tracks total distance traveled.
  • Trip: Shows distance for the current trip.
  • Error Code: Displays diagnostic codes if an issue occurs.

Controls:

  • Power On/Off: Press and hold the 'M' button for two seconds to turn the display on/off.
  • Pedal Assist Levels: Use the '+' and '-' buttons on the left handlebar to adjust between 5 pedal assist levels. Level 0 is no assist.
  • Throttle: The throttle is located on the right handlebar. Twist it to engage pure electric mode.
  • Headlight Activation: Press and hold the 'M' and '+' buttons simultaneously for 2-3 seconds to turn the headlight on/off.
  • Gear Shifter: Use the Shimano 7-speed shifter on the right handlebar to change gears manually.

7. Battery & Charging

The R3 is equipped with a 48V 13.6AH Lithium battery. It offers two convenient charging methods:

  • Direct Charging: Plug the charger directly into the charging port on the bike.
  • Removable Battery Charging: Use the key to unlock and remove the battery from the frame, then charge it separately.

A full charge takes approximately 5 hours. Always use the official Gotrax charger.

8. Folding & Storage

The R3's foldable design makes it highly portable and easy to store. The folded size is approximately 35.4"x20.5"x29.3".

Folding Steps:

  1. Lower the seat post to its lowest position.
  2. Release the quick-release lever on the handlebar stem and fold the handlebars down.
  3. Locate the main frame folding latch (near the pedals), release the safety catch, and open the latch to fold the bike in half.
  4. Secure the folded bike with any integrated clasps to prevent it from unfolding during transport.

11. Specifications

FeatureSpecification
Bike TypeElectric Bike
Model NameR3
Motor500W Brushless
Top Speed20 MPH
Battery48V 13.6AH Lithium
Pedal Assist RangeUp to 70 miles (Level 1)
Pure Electric RangeUp to 28 miles
Charging Time5 hours
Wheel Size20 Inches
Tire Size20" x 4"
GearsShimano 7-Speed
Brake StyleDual Disc Brake
Suspension TypeDual Front Suspension
Frame MaterialAluminum
Folded Size35.4"x20.5"x29.3"
Weight CapacityMax 264 lbs
UL CertificationUL2849
